As discussed, Halverd Analytics intends to adjust pricing for customers remaining on the legacy Meridian contracts. The proposed increase averages six percent, phased over two billing cycles, with exceptions for accounts under active renegotiation. Finance should validate the revenue model, confirm churn assumptions against last year's adjustment, and stress-test the discount guardrails before notices are drafted. Legal has cleared the contract language. I'd like sign-off by the end of next week. The underlying rationale is noted below.

board note of bajop-yaweg: The western region missed its Pelys quota by 58.0 percent last quarter. Pelysek Foods plans to raise the Belius list price by 44.0 percent in July. The steering committee signed off on a budget of $133.8 million for Project Pelax. The renewal with Zoraelix Systems closes at $61.9 million a year, 12.7 percent above the last contract.

Capacity note for the Fennelgrid sidecar review. Aggregation window widened to cut emit rate; per-pod memory ceiling holds at current cardinality (~12k series). CPU flat. Risk: buffer overflow if a tenant spikes labels — mitigated by the drop policy. No node-pool changes needed for the Caldermoor cluster this quarter. Review the flush and buffer settings before merge. Constants under review are below.

limits module of yafop-hahag:
QUOTAS = {
    "tamwyn": 652,
    "prawyn": 731,
}

Crash reports from the Mossfin mobile app land in the intake queue, get symbolicated, then flow to the triage board. If the pipeline stalls, check the symbolicator first — it's usually out of disk. Restarting the worker is safe and loses nothing. The worker won't boot without its ingest credential, so add that secret on the very next line.

vault entry, yahif-yajep: COURIER_KEY29=b802bdf8034096b65a51c6ba5abe2

Lost badges at Quarrow Gate must be treated as a live security matter. The facilities desk should deactivate the badge in the access system before anything else, then record the holder's name, the time reported, and the last known location of the badge. A temporary pass may be issued for the same day only, and the visitor log must note its return. While the temporary pass is being prepared, the holder may use the escort-door code below.

door code, yagap-bahof: bdg-O-05